About the Role
The Installer works as a core member of a residential solar installation construction crew under the direction of a Foreperson and Lead Installer. You will help execute solar PV system installations on residential properties, including module placement, racking assembly, electrical connections, and site completion.
Responsibilities
- Maintain safety protocols for yourself, crew members, and job sites; participate in safety training and hazard reporting
- Review and stock crew trucks with necessary materials and equipment from loading dock inventory
- Lay out, assemble, and position solar modules, racking systems, mechanical mounts, and electrical components per project specifications
- Apply weather sealing to roofing and building structures
- Clean job sites and installation vehicles to maintain orderly work environments and customer satisfaction
- Work collaboratively to meet project timelines and performance metrics
Requirements
- Previous solar, construction, or military experience preferred but not required
- Demonstrated commitment to safety procedures and ability to identify and report hazards
- Professional and courteous communication with customers and coworkers
- Ability to transport materials and equipment up to 50 pounds frequently and up to 100 pounds with assistance
- Capability to work on rooftops of varying angles and surfaces, including frequent bending, twisting, squatting, climbing, kneeling, crawling, and balance work
- Comfort climbing ladders and working at heights
- Ability to work in outdoor weather conditions including heat, cold, wet environments, and humidity
- Fine motor skills for precise hand work including grasping and manipulation
- Safe use of ladders, fall protection harnesses, and personal protective equipment
- Ability to work safely on rafters, roof tiles, and shingles without causing damage
- Color vision sufficient to distinguish red, black, yellow, white, and green
- Ability to work in confined spaces such as attics, basements, and crawls spaces
- Capable of hearing verbal commands and safety warnings
- Ability to work safely with chemicals and apply appropriate protections
